Class SessionUtil


  • public class SessionUtil
    extends Object
    Author:
    Giancarlo Panichi
    • Constructor Detail

      • SessionUtil

        public SessionUtil()
    • Method Detail

      • getServiceCredentials

        public static org.gcube.data.analysis.dataminermanagercl.server.util.ServiceCredentials getServiceCredentials​(javax.servlet.http.HttpServletRequest httpServletRequest,
                                                                                                                      String token)
                                                                                                               throws ServiceException
        Throws:
        ServiceException
      • getTaskWrapperMap

        public static HashMap<String,​TaskWrapper> getTaskWrapperMap​(javax.servlet.http.HttpSession httpSession,
                                                                          org.gcube.data.analysis.dataminermanagercl.server.util.ServiceCredentials serviceCredentials)
        Parameters:
        httpSession - http session
        serviceCredentials - service credentials
        Returns:
        hash map of tasks
      • setTaskWrapperMap

        public static void setTaskWrapperMap​(javax.servlet.http.HttpSession httpSession,
                                             org.gcube.data.analysis.dataminermanagercl.server.util.ServiceCredentials serviceCredentials,
                                             HashMap<String,​TaskWrapper> taskWrapperMap)
        Parameters:
        httpSession - session
        serviceCredentials - service credentials
        taskWrapperMap - task wrapper map